Young Amanita phalloides "Demise cap" mushrooms, with a matchbox for measurement comparison Several mushroom species make secondary metabolites which can be toxic, brain-altering, antibiotic, antiviral, or bioluminescent. Although you'll find only a little range of lethal species, several Other folks could cause especially critical and uncomfortable signs. Toxicity probable plays a role in guarding the purpose of the basidiocarp: the mycelium has expended substantial Electricity and protoplasmic substance to acquire a composition to proficiently distribute its spores.

Finer distinctions are often made to distinguish the categories of attached gills: adnate gills, which adjoin squarely to the stalk; notched gills, that are notched in which they join the best in the stalk; adnexed gills, which curve upward to satisfy the stalk, and so on. These distinctions between hooked up gills are sometimes hard to interpret, considering that gill attachment may possibly improve given that the mushroom matures, or with different environmental circumstances.[12]
